Fisker has officially released the name of its upcoming electric SUV, which is called the Ocean. Fisker has been teasing its new EV for a while now and although we still have to wait until January 4, 2020 to see it, we at least now know what it will be called.

The Fisker Ocean should have a driving range between 250-300 miles thanks to its 80 kWh battery, plus a solar panel on the roof will add about 1,000 miles of driving range a year. Inside the Ocean is packed with sustainable materials, like regenerated nylon carpeting that’s made from abandoned fishing net waste and eco-suede interior textures, which are made from recycled polyester fibers from old t-shirts and plastic bottles.

Fisker also says that it will repurpose the rubber waste that’s generated during tire production, but it doesn’t say what it will do with it.

Production of the Fisker Ocean is slated to begin production at the end of 2021, which means the first deliveries will happen in 2022.
